Movies Logo
Home
Movies
TV Shows
People
Trending
Settings
Menu
An image from Along Came a Spider, one of the productions that also features Teresa Kelly.
Teresa Kelly
—
Known for
Credits
Images
6.3
Along Came a Spider
2001
6.9
The Dig
2021
6.4
Hot Rod
2007
Scroll to top